What Is Quick Rolled Oat?

Oats that have been steamed, flattened, and cut into smaller pieces, allowing for a much faster cooking time than regular rolled oats.

Quick Rolled Oat Substitutes & Ratios

The best substitute for Quick Rolled Oat is Regular Rolled Oats, used at a 1:1 ratio. Requires longer cooking but similar texture and flavor, slightly chewier.

Substitutes for Quick Rolled Oat with ratios
Substitute Ratio Best for
Regular Rolled Oats Best 1:1 Requires longer cooking but similar texture and flavor, slightly chewier.
Steel-Cut Oats 1:1 (volume, adjust liquid/time) Chewier texture, nuttier flavor, significantly longer cooking time.
Oat Bran 1:1 (for thickening/fiber) Higher fiber, often used as an additive or for a very smooth porridge.
Mashed Banana (in baking) 1:1 (for moisture/binding) For gluten-free baking or to add moisture and a different texture.
